Networking Essentials: Implementation
Product Code: NESC05 Time: 7 Hour(s) CEUs: .70

Summary:

This training course deals with the process of implementing resource sharing on a Microsoft network, examines how the use of fault-tolerant disk configurations and a backup strategy can help reduce the danger of lost time and data, and describes the processes of installing and configuring network adapter cards.

Objectives:

After completing this training course , students will be able to:
  • Choose an administrative plan to meet specified needs, including performance management, account management, and security
  • Choose a disaster recovery plan for various situations
  • Given the manufacturer's documentation for the network adapter, to install, configure, and resolve hardware conflicts for multiple adapters in a Token Ring or Ethernet network

Outline:

  • Resource Sharing Basics
  • User Accounts and Groups in Windows NT
  • Implementing Security on Windows NT
  • Implementing Security on Windows 95
  • Printers and Administrative Tasks
  • Disaster Recovery
  • Using RAID
  • Network Adapter Cards
  • Installing Network Adapter Cards
  • Configuring Network Adapter Cards

Features:

  • Exercises that allow users to practice the application
  • A file containing the text of the exercises
  • Simulations that allow users to practice training course skills, even if they don't have access to the application
  • A glossary

Applicability:

This training course is for anyone preparing for the MCSE Networking Essentials exam 70-058 or anyone who wants to learn more about implementing a network.
